函數(shù)參數(shù)怎么引用數(shù)組 vba如何將數(shù)組作為參數(shù)?
vba如何將數(shù)組作為參數(shù)?兩者都可以使用。第二個(gè)不能引用單元格范圍。每個(gè)單元格都是一個(gè)參數(shù),需要用逗號(hào)分隔。第一個(gè)更接近于內(nèi)置函數(shù)sum“選項(xiàng)explicit function sum(ByVal r
vba如何將數(shù)組作為參數(shù)?
兩者都可以使用。第二個(gè)不能引用單元格范圍。每個(gè)單元格都是一個(gè)參數(shù),需要用逗號(hào)分隔。第一個(gè)更接近于內(nèi)置函數(shù)sum“選項(xiàng)explicit function sum(ByVal range as range)as double dim RNG as range for each RNG in range sum=sum額定值下一個(gè)rngEnd函數(shù)函數(shù)Ssum0(ParamArray arr())作為雙精度I作為整數(shù),用于I=lbound(arr)到UBound(arr)如果是數(shù)字(arr(I)),則Ssum0=Ssum0 arr(I)如果下一個(gè)iend函數(shù)結(jié)束
VB6中的所有數(shù)組都是作為參數(shù)傳遞的地址。Private Sub Command1uclick()Dim a(3)As Integera(0)=1a(1)=2a(2)=3a(3)=4arr aEnd SubPrivate Sub arr(ByRef arr()As Integer)Dim i As integerfori=0 UBound(arr)Print arr(i)next Sub